There are several tests that are used by counselors to predict the success of individuals . The tests range from projective personality testing , individual intellectual assessment , achievement tests and many others . Achievement tests which deal with the assessment of the skills knowledge and accomplishments in an area of interest levels is the most used kind of test by counselors . Achievement testing focuses on what the client knows or what the client can do in the

present time Achievement tests are such as California Achievement Test , Metropolitan Achievement Test , WIAT , WAIS and many others (Bradford , 1998

These tests are meant to show the current trends of performance of individuals . When counselors use the information from the assessment report , then they can be able to predict if an individual will be successful or not . This kind of assessment may not be effective as the predictive validity of this instrument has to be known . One can use an approach with the knowledge that it is effective , not knowing that the quality of services he /she is offering using that service is low . It therefore creates a barrier to other effective methods that can be used (Carlson , 2007
